Key Market Players Are Expected to Strengthen the Market Position by Joining Hands to Create Improved Bioplastics The major producers of bioplastics are present in Europe and North America. Some of the key market players include NatureWorks, Total Corbion NV, Succinity GmbH, and PTT MCC Biochem. NatureWorks is a partnership of Cargill and PHH (an oil company in Thailand) for manufacturing PLA. Total Corbion NV is a joint venture of Total and Corbion, which also deals in the manufacture of PLA. On the other hand, Corbion has entered a joint venture with BASF to form Succinity GmbH, which manufactures Succinic Acid and its derivatives. Other key players in the bioplastics market have also focused on developing a strong regional presence, distribution channels, but the most important strategy employed by the key participants is development of their product offerings.

Key Industry Developments

In December 2019

, Kaneka Takasago Factory up-scaled its PHBH production capacity to 5 KT per year along with approval of FDA for usage of PHBH as a food contact material.

In November 2019

, Danimer Scientific set up a PHA manufacturing plant in Winchester, Kentucky, U.S. At this plant the company degrades cellulose powder with the help of sea water to form the precursor to the polymerization process. The PHA manufactured is trademarked as Nodax.

In January 2019

, Taghleef Industries completed acquisition of Biofilm, a Latin American manufacturer of BOPP films for flexible packaging in industrial applications. In December 2018, Total Corbion NV started production at its production facility in Rayong, Thailand. The facility has annual production capacity of 75 KT and uses non-GMO sugarcane grown locally to manufacture high heat PLA and PDLA
